【Machine Learning】What is it? + Applications and Types ▷ 2022

The The use of machines has become an integral part of everyone’s daily life.and in humanity’s search for an easier and more productive life, machines have been created capable of learning on their own.

This is what it’s all about machine learning, an advanced branch of programming that gives computers the ability to learn without being programmed to do soin order to offer a more optimal service to people.

In the next few paragraphs, we will delve into the topic of machine learning and in all the learning systems applied by the machines you use in your daily life.

What is machine learning and what is this branch of artificial intelligence for?

It is a branch of artificial intelligence that allows machines to decipher patterns in order to make predictionsessentially learning from the user with little to no supervision.

In the middle of the year 2021, this technology was applied to a large number of everyday devicesas the recommendations in platforms like Netflix or Spotifyand the smart responses from either . In short, is a series of protocols that allow a machine to develop prediction algorithms that adapt to user behavior and the ability to predict it to provide faster and more personalized services.

How does machine learning work and how much does it influence our experience on the Internet?

Unlike classic computing procedures, where for a machine to perform an action it was necessary to program it with specific algorithms, the algorithms used in the machine learning they perform a large part of the actions on their own. These perform automatic calculations based on information collected from the user’s interaction with the system, and the more data they collect, the more accurate the calculations will be and the better the predictions will be.

Today, machine learning is so ingrained in most aspects of daily life, that it is practically impossible to use the internet without resorting to it. For example, machine learning is present in the smart recommendations from google searchthe detection of faces of your Smartphone, the one in your emailamong many other aspects.

History of machine learning When was it born and what were the first programs developed?

Although its use has expanded recently, the origins of machine learning date back to the 1950s, when the famous Alan Turing created the “Turing Test”, a test that, in order to pass it, forced a machine to fool a human into thinking they were in front of another person. Later, in 1952, Arthur Samuel wrote the first dynamic algorithm capable of learningby creating a program to play checkers that improved his strategies with each game played.

See also  【 +10 Websites to Consult Cheap Gas Stations 】 List ▷ 2022

Later, at a conference held in 1956, the term “Artificial Intelligence” was first coined as the official name for this new field of computing that was being studied. The 70s were a difficult time for this branch of technology, due to the irrational expectations of investors, compared to the few discoveries made.

This until 1967 when the algorithm was created Nearest Neighbor”, a form of supervised learning that was used for prediction, or classification of new samples. The first rule-based dedicated systems were born in the 1980s, shortly before interest in the machine learning was drastically reduced for the second time, losing support until the early years of the 21st century.

in the early years 2000, specifically in the year 2003, Google creates a file system called “Google File System” and in 2004 it finished its file processing system, called “Map & reduce”. Later, in 2006, engineers from the Appalachian University completed Google’s data processing model. with the first Big Data platform from , called Hadoop.

Currently, the machine learning forms an integral part of the business worldas it is present in applications in all kinds of sectors, from small start-ups, to large companies that update their procedures.

Machine learning algorithms What are they and what types exist so far?

The machine learning is made up of a wide variety of algorithms that provide different rates and procedures for learning to the machines that use them.

Among the most used are:

supervised

The supervised machine learning is a modality of machine learning that allows researchers to understand how algorithms learn to interpret information entered by users.

Among the main characteristics of this modality of machine learning are:

  • The introduction, labeling and classification of the data processed by the algorithm require human intervention.
  • The output data of the algorithms are expected, since the input data has been classified by the person entering it.
  • This algorithm supports the introduction of classification data, that allow to classify an object in different classes; and regression datawhich allows you to predict a numeric value.

East type of machine learning facilitates the prediction of point data and specific to obtain expected results.

Among the practical applications of this type of learning we can highlight:

  • Insurance companies: they use it to determine the costs of a claim.
  • Bank entities: allows them to perform fraud assessments and detection
  • Companies in general: It allows to anticipate the breakdown of machinery.
See also  Thanks G! Google gives us a beautiful Doodle that will allow you to create your own arcade minigame very easily

not supervised

Unlike the supervised form, this type of algorithms do not require human intervention. The entered data contains unclassified elements, and the algorithm automatically looks for patterns among them.

Among its most outstanding features are:

  • The data entered they are not classified or labeled.
  • Does not require human intervention to work.
  • It includes algorithms clustering, which classifies the output data into groups, and association that deciphers rules and patterns within the entered data.

Practical applications for unsupervised Machine Learning respond to other types of demands:

  • entities banking: It is used to classify bank customers by type.
  • Health centers: classifies patients according to different criteria.
  • Streaming platforms: forms the recommendation system for a series or music transmission platform.

Reinforced

Is a behavioral psychology methodology transferred to machine learning, in which machines learn on their own to follow a set of rules and behaviors based on rewards and penalties.

The main characteristics of the reinforced larynx machine are:

  • It is based on reinforcement learning behavioral psychology.
  • Gives the machine the ability to make decisions based on experience.
  • It focuses on the development of a system, called “Agent”which seeks to improve their efficiency when interacting with their environment and the use of rewards to modify their behavior.

Some of the practical applications for reinforcement learning algorithms are:

  • Navigation systems: it is used in the navigation systems of autonomous vehicles, drones and even robots.
  • Refinement of designs: It is used in the manufacture of parts and the selection of materials to reduce costs or increase quality.
  • Resource management: allows you to manage stock records or staff rotation shifts.

Semi-supervised learning

It is a machine learning methodology that employs both categorized and uncategorized data entry.

Typically, a small portion of the former along with a larger portion of the latter can greatly improve the accuracy of learning:

  • only require partial human supervision.
  • The labeled data corresponds to a small part of all training data entered.
  • their algorithms they meet the same objectives as supervised and unsupervised learning.

The practical applications of this type of machine learning are similar to those of supervised and unsupervised learningwith the difference that it can be more accurate and cheaper than the other two modalities.

See also  【Change TikTok Password and Activate 2FA】Step by Step Guide ▷ 2022

transduction

It is a learning system with similarities to supervised learning, but with the difference that its learning criteria, that is, the input data, they are used for the prediction of future data based on their categories and comparing them with the new input data. Its most viewed practical application is in the predictive texts of some smart keyboardas well as predictions from search engines like Google.

Multitask

It is a learning method focuses on the use of previously acquired data to solve problems of a similar nature to those already seen. In short, you solve multiple learning tasks simultaneously while looking for similarities between them to improve your efficiency when solving future tasks. This method is one of the fastest for machine learning and provides an improvement in learning efficiency and prediction accuracy.

Machine Learning Techniques What are the main strategies used to teach machines?

Inside of the machine learning a large number of techniques are used to enter the information to algorithmsin order to allow them to perform their own calculations, regardless of the classification of the information entered.

Let’s see next:

Regression

East method corresponds to supervised machine learningand consists of the prediction explanation of a numerical value using previously entered data or sets as a base. For example, an algorithm using regression learning can calculate the value of real estate based on input data that represent previous prices for properties with similar characteristics.

Decisions Tree

Use a decision tree as a predictive model for mapping observations about the data entered with the aim of reaching a final conclusion about said data. It is one of the most effective methods to keep track of machine learning progress, since it allows to visualize previous decisions and compare them with future problems.

Group

It falls under the category of unsupervised machine learning, its objective is to make the machine group or classify data sets with similar characteristics, allowing the algorithm to perform this classification automatically. Because it is an automatic process performed by the algorithm, the only way the quality of solutions to problems can be assessed is

Loading Facebook Comments ...
Loading Disqus Comments ...